Have you determined whether the problem is in the headphones or in your computer?  For example, if you plug the headphones into a stereo, do they work?  If you plug a pair of speakers into the headphone jack on your computer, do they work?

I've had similar problems, and usually it's come obscure setting in Control Panel that gets changed.
